Separate return decisions from transport decisions

Your retail process should approve the return and assign its destination before WTM collects it. A refund, exchange, warranty repair and surplus-store transfer may lead to different receiving points.

Use a return reference that your team can connect with the original order. Keep the physical package identifiable without placing unnecessary customer information on its exterior.

Group only the returns that belong together

Prepare collections by authorised destination and ready date. Separate supplier returns from goods returning to your own warehouse so the receiving team does not have to untangle a mixed shipment.

Count the outer packages after they are packed. Identify damaged items or special contents before booking; a general description such as “holiday returns” does not explain the handling required.

Do not put goods still awaiting approval into the released collection area.

Give stores a workable release process

Nominate a staff contact and a prepared-return area at each location. Record which packages are ready for the collection and which remain with the store.

A retail team serving customers needs a simple handoff list. Use the return reference, destination and package count to connect the physical boxes with the collection request.

At the receiving end, confirm the correct entrance, operating hours and any appointment requirement. More incoming boxes are useful only when the destination is ready to process them.

Track the transportation, then close your retail record

Use the WTM Customer Portal to manage requests, quote approval, payment and shipment progress. Retrieve the POD and invoice after the destination accepts delivery.

The retailer or supplier then completes its inspection and refund process. A POD confirms the handoff; it does not automatically authorise a customer refund.
